Development

  • The ODR-CS (Overdrive Custom Special) is the successor to my development (ODR-S) from 1993. It has two consecutive distortion stages. The first is a classic overdrive circuit with two silicon diodes in the feedback path of an operational amplifier (also called soft clipping). At the end of this stage, two germanium diodes were added as limiters. (So called hard clipping).
  • Unfortunately, these special germanium diodes have not been manufactured for decades. In my opinion, a new edition was no longer possible in series. But then, after a long search and a bit of luck, I had the chance to acquire a few thousand good sounding germanium diodes as NOS◊ 
    • NOS: New Old Stock – i.e. new goods that have been stored for a very long time!
  • Based on today’s experience, I was able to significantly improve the quality of the old ODR-S. I then revised the sound control, since the old control could still be refined today – 30 years later.
  • Unfortunately, germanium semiconductors have always had a very high degree of scatter in the manufacturing process. This meant that each device always sounded slightly different. In order to keep the scatter small, I measure the germanium diodes with a characteristic curve recorder and select them based on their forward voltage. Finally, I adjust the effect of the germanium diodes with an internal bias control!

Improvements

  • 9 V to 18 V: The built-in components can handle 18 volts without any problems. The sound of the ODR-CS changes at an operating voltage between 9 V and 18 V. Please try it yourself!!
  • Protection against polarity reversal: The device blocks in the event of polarity reversal and thus protects the electronics.
  • True Bypass Footswitch: No loss of sound in bypass (effect off).
  • Soft footswitch click – more comfortable than the usual hard toggles.
  • Use of high-quality materials, such as: Stable Hammond MFG (England) 1590N1 aluminum housing, gold-plated Cliff jack sockets (also English company), gold-plated board connectors, boards with ENIG gold-plated pads, 1% (tolerance) metal film resistors and max. 5% film capacitors in the audio signal path for best sound quality.
  • Soft-LED: Gentle on/off thread of the LED brightness to optimally suppress switching clicks.
  • An LED brightness knob-potentiometer is located inside the ODR-CS!
  •  Selected germanium diodes with an internal bias knob for sound adjustment.
  • A little G.D.C. knob that can reduce the effect of the germanium diodes (hard clipping).
  • Optimized tone control for bass and treble.
  • Extended sound control for the mid knob: not only adds mids, but can now also remove them.

Connection to a DC power-supply:
Connect the DC-socket D to a standard power-supply (hum-free, electronically stabilized!). The voltage must be between 9 V and 18 V. Depending on the operating voltage, the device requires between 15 mA and 25 mA. The power- supply should be able to deliver at least 50 mA. The inner pole of the socket (5.5 mm / 2.1 mm) is ground, the outer ring must be on plus (+). If the polarity is wrong, the built-in reverse polarity protection prevents (to a certain extent) damage to the ODR-CS. Nevertheless, it should be avoided, since when using other devices on this power supply, the positive contact on the housing (usually: ground) is applied. As a result, touching or wiring with another device may cause a short circuit in this power supply unit and possibly damage it!

LED Brightness
A brightness knob N for the LED is located inside the ODR-CS. To do this, the base plate must be removed. With the knob wheel, the brightness can be adjusted very easily with your finger or thumb.

Effect On
The true bypass-switch G turns the effect on / off. The LED F lights up when the effect is on. The signal is routed from the input-jack, through the footswitch directly to the output-jack. A resistor of 2 MΩ across this signal is grounded to divert DC offset-voltages, or vice versa capacitors to discharge, which reduces the switching-noise!
Attention: Before switching on, please make sure that the volume H is set so low that any impairment or damage of any kind (health: hearing, electrical: loudspeakers, amplifiers) is excluded.

Level
This knob H adjusts the output-volume of the ODR-CS.

Drive

  • This knob I set the degree of overdrive. It can be adjusted between “almost clean” and “heavily overdriven”.
  • The volume changes depending on the position. Then adjust the volume with the level control H if necessary.

G.D.C. (Germanium Drive Control)

  • The effect of the germanium diodes can be set with this knob J.
    • If the Drive knob I is turned up a little, the G.D.C. knob J adjusts the sound of the distortion (Germanium distortion!).
    • If the Drive knob I is turned up wide and the G.D.C. Knob is in the right area, you primarily hear the sound of the silicon diodes (overdrive).
    • You get a good low gain drive sound, for example, when the Drive control I is turned up a little (~ 9 o’clock) and the G.D.C. Knob J is between 9 o’clock and 12 o’clock.
  • The germanium diodes reduce the output volume. At the left stop it is significantly lower (max. distortion or limitation) than if the G.D.C. J knob is turned clockwise.
    • In order to get into the area of the ODR-S (from 1993), the G.D.C. knob must be set to the left stop!

Sound-Examples

These Drive, G.D.C. and Level settings are just examples and will certainly vary with you depending on what guitar, amp, etc. you are using 😉
Examples also without any bass – mid – treble settings – please adjust them as desired

  1. Low Gain Germanium Drive I:
    Set Drive to 8 o’clock position. Depending on your pickups (Single coil or Humbucker) you get a very low overdrive sound but with max.

  2. Low Gain Germanium Drive II:
    Now increase G.D.C. a bit to around 10 o’clock, but also decrease the level because less G.D.C means higher output level!

  3. Booster / Low Gain Drive:
    Now set G.D.C. to its right stop to minimize the effect of the Germanium diodes. Increase the level for your desired boost output level!

  4. Lead Sound / Silicon Overdrive:
    Using more Drive you will have a nice overdriven sound good for lead guitar. Adjust the Level for your desired output volume.

  5. Mixed Silicon / Germanium Overdrive:
    In these positions you have a mixture of silicon and germanium. Tweak G.D.C. for your taste!

  6. ODR-S Overdrive
    Like #5 but with max. Germanium hard-clipping (G.D.C. left stop). A typical sound as it was generated by the ODR-S

Technical Data

  • Input impedance ~1 MΩ,
  • Output impedance ~1 kΩ
  • DC-Power supply : 9 V to 18 V (electronically stabilized)
  • Consumption: approx: 14 mA at 9 V, approx. 18 mA at 18 V
  • Powered by battery DC 9 V:
    • Dry battery 6F22 (9 V)-Type (Carbon). Lifetime approx. 21 hours @ 300mAh
    • Dry battery 6LR61 (9 V)-Type (alkaline manganese) Lifetime approx. 35 hours @ 500mAh
  • Dimensions 125 (l) x 66 (w) x 58 (h) mm
  • Weight ~ 360 g (without battery, not included!)
